One of the most common questions I am asked at classes is what should I keep in my first aid kit? The answer to this is greatly dependent on which bag they are asking about. My first aid kit has equipment to treat minor injuries as well as a face mask and PPE in case I have to do CPR. The bag I keep for teaching firearms classes has all of the things in my first aid kit but includes items to deal with gunshot wounds and other major trauma, and my bag for use while doing volunteer work as a medic is even more in depth. But for the purposes of answering the question I will share what I keep in my volunteering bag which also doubles as my tactical medic bag.

  • 20 x bandaids 1×3
  • 20x butterfly bandages
  • 10 x large bandages 
  • 6 x mini burn gel packets 
  • 2 x Kerlix 4″ Gauze 
  • 6 x Kerlix 3″ Gauze 
  • 2 x 1″ surgical tape 
  • 20 x 4×4 Gauze 
  • 10 x 2×2 gauze 
  • 10 x ABD Pads 
  • 4 x Compressed Gauze 
  • 2 x SAM Splint 
  • 4 x 4″ Ace Wrap 
  • 2 x HALO vented chest seals
  • 1 x Eye Wash 
  • 1 x 6″ Israeli Bandage
  • 4 x 4″ Israeli Bandage
  • 1 x abdominal Israeli Bandage
  • 4 x Mylar Blanket 
  • 6 x Cravats (Triangular Bandage) 
  • 2 x 7.5″ Trauma Shears (plus I carry them on my gear and my belt)
  • 2 x QuikClot Bleeding Control Dressing (12 ft)
  • 4 x QuikClot Bleeding Control Dressing (4 ft)
  • 4 x 4×4 EMS QuikClot Pads
  • 4 x CAT TQ 
  • 10 pair x Nitrile Gloves 
  • 2 x 28 French NPA’s, as well as a full selection with lubricating jelly
  • 2 assorted Oral Airways
  • 1 x Large Burn Gel 
  • Vionex wipes x 10 
  • Glucose Gel x 1 
  • Soothe-a-Sting Wipes x 10
  • Tylenol 2/pk x 5 pk – bottles
  • Motrin 2/pk x 5 pk – bottles
  • Aspirin 2/pk x 5/pk  – bottles
  • CPR Mask
  • 2 x Flashlight
  • 4 x Chemical Ice Pack
  • 4 Calum Light Sticks – Orange
  • 2 x Towels

    when I am able I will also carry blind insertion airways (King) as well as a Bag Valve Mask
    Knee pads
    blanket roll
    Duct Tape
    Sharpies
